The University of Toledo will celebrate graduates from the Class of 2026 during spring commencement ceremonies starting on Friday, May 1, at John F. Savage Arena on UToledo's Main Campus.
The University will confer more than 2,100 degrees and graduate certificates at multiple ceremonies steeped in proud Rocket tradition, including 129 doctoral, 432 master's, 1,416 bachelor's and 76 associate's degrees this weekend.

May 1-2 Ceremony Details
The doctoral hooding and graduate commencement is scheduled for 6 p.m. Friday, May 1, followed by two undergraduate Commencement Ceremonies on Saturday, May 2.
The morning May 2 ceremony begins at 9 a.m. and will recognize graduating students from the Judith Herb College of Arts, Social Sciences and Education, the College of Engineering, College of Medicine and Life Sciences, College of Natural Sciences and Mathematics, and College of Pharmacy and Pharmaceutical Sciences.
The afternoon May 2 undergraduate ceremony begins at 1 p.m. and will honor graduating students in the John B. and Lillian E. Neff College of Business and Innovation, College of Health and Human Services and University College.
Due to capacity and fire code regulations, tickets are required for admission to these commencement ceremonies.

Law and Medicine
In addition, the UToledo College of Law will celebrate 82 graduating students at 1 p.m. Sunday, May 10, in Thompson Student Union Auditorium, and the College of Medicine and Life Sciences will honor 209 graduating students at 2 p.m. Friday, May 15, in Savage Arena.
